SAFE SPACE IN ALL STAR

The All Star Wellness Committee is working towards the concept of removing the stigma associated with mental health, specifically within the sport. Safe Space is a universal term that refers to a place intended to be free of bias, conflict, criticism, or potentially threatening actions, ideas, or conversations. The All Star Wellness Committee provides credible resources, awareness tools, and learning opportunities that foster the concept of developing and maintaining a Safe Space in All Star.


MENTAL HEALTH MONDAY

Created by the All Star Wellness Committee, this series of quizzes on mental health topics, such as apathy, depression and anxiety, was designed to help coaches recognize and respond effectively to the needs of athletes and dancers. You may have seen some of these scenarios in your own club, so check out each one to view recommended responses.
